AVIATION.
EXHIBITION AT. TIMARU. The Sockburn Aviation Company is mapping out a route from Christehurch t<o lnvercargill, along' which Mr C. M- Hill (chief instructor at-Sockbiirn) will take an aeroplane, •'stopping at-the:' various centres* to givV exuibrtions ,of Hying. With this object in .view Messrs Hill and. C. t AY-.' Heryey are making a. motor tour picking out suitable landing places -along the route. These gentlemen arrived izi Timaru on Monday afternoon and yesterday with Mr H. H. Fraser went in search-of a landing place for Timarii, finally selecting the, racecourse at Washdyke. The Jockey Club's consent having been secured, it was decided to hold an, exhibition on the racecourse oh Thursday, February ]3th. Short trips for passengers will also be arranged, and the Mayor (Mr James Maling) has consented to he Mr Hill's first ger on that "day. It is thought that the exhibition will commence at 2.30 p.m., and a. special train, has been arranged'for, to leave Timaru at 2 o'clock. Mr Hill will first; do some flying "stunts," to.be followed by passenger flights. Mr Fraser lias been appointed the Company's 'agent hero.' and flights maybe booked with him. Mr B. Tripp has already booked two seats. Passages maybe booked from. Ashbiirton = to Timaru, Timaru to Onmaru,and on the return journey Timaru to Ashburton. Messrs Hill and Hcivev left for Oamaru yesterday afternoon, where flights will be given the same as in Tim'aVu.
